behind in or at the back of; on the other side of.
bold having courage; having little or no fear.
brave ready to face pain or danger; showing courage.
button a small, round, flat thing that fastens clothing by fitting through a hole.
city a large and important town where many people live and work.
ditch a long narrow opening in the ground used to drain away or supply water.
doubt to not be certain or confident about something; to think that something might not be true.
family a group made up of a parent or parents and their children.
grand splendid in size or appearance.
knot a tying together of material such as rope or string that is used to fasten.
mask a covering that hides all or part of the face.
palm the inner surface of the hand.
shell a hard outer covering that an animal, especially a sea animal, has made to protect itself.
squeeze to press firmly together.
super (informal) excellent; very good.
